Techtronic Industries (TTI) is a world leader in cordless technology spanning power tools, accessories, hand tools, outdoor power equipment, as well as floorcare & cleaning products. Our focus is on end-users that range from professionals in the industrial, construction and infrastructure sectors to DIYers in home improvement, repair, and maintenance. TTI’s powerful brand portfolio includes MILWAUKEE®, RYOBI®, AEG® - recognized worldwide for their deep heritage and innovative product platforms of superior quality.  
 
The company maintains a global manufacturing and product development footprint, with record world-wide sales of approximately US$15.2 billion and around 50,000 employees in 2026. Your Responsibilities :

In this role, you will strengthen our sustainability reporting, enhance data quality, and improve audit readiness across key ESG topics. You will act as a central link, aligning data management, compliance, and internal audit processes.

  • Support ESG reporting with a focus on increased HKEX evidence requirements, including emissions data collection, validation, and documentation

  • Ensure audit-ready sustainability data by implementing and maintaining robust validation and control processes

  • Manage and further develop CBAM reporting processes in preparation for expanded regulatory requirements

  • Coordinate and validate Product Carbon Footprint (PCF) data, including BOM-based calculations and supplier data requests

  • Engage with internal stakeholders and suppliers to enhance data availability, consistency, and traceability

  • Plan and conduct internal audits (e.g., ISO as co-auditor and sustainability as lead auditor), including documentation, reporting of findings, and follow-up actions

  • Contribute to the development of sustainability controls, audit frameworks, and continuous improvement initiatives

  • Support the preparation of assessments for rating platforms (e.g. Ecovadis)

Your Profile:

  • Degree or equivalent technical education in Sustainability, Environmental Management, Engineering, Business Analytics, or a related field

  • Extensive experience in ESG reporting, sustainability data management, or auditing

  • Solid knowledge of GHG accounting, ESG frameworks, and relevant regulatory requirements (e.g., ESRS/CSRD, CBAM, PPWR, DPP)

  • Experience with data validation, audit processes, or internal controls is a plus

  • Proficiency in Excel; experience with ESG tools (e.g., Envizi, Power BI) is a plus

  • Good command of English; German is a plus
